Measurement devices for HVAC design and maintenance
October 2016Maintenance, Test & Measurement, Calibration
RS Components has extended its portfolio of high-quality electrical test and measurement devices with five innovative product ranges from Testo. The devices offer measurement capabilities for a diverse variety of electrical systems and appliances, including for use by electrical installation contractors and engineers working in HVAC design and maintenance.
The Testo 760 is an automatic digital multimeter range and provides functionality for all electrical measuring tasks, including function keys that replace the traditional dial for easier operation and greater reliability. Measurement parameters are detected automatically via the assignment of measuring sockets; therefore, it is impossible to make incorrect settings. Three models are available: the standard Testo 760-1, which covers most daily measuring tasks; the Testo 760-2 offering TRMS measurement, an extended current range from μA up to 10 A; and the high-specification 760-3, which has additional features including voltage up to 1000 V and higher ranges for frequency and capacitance.
The Testo 770 clamp meter range is ideally suited to current measurement in switching cabinets, as the device’s unique grab mechanism allows one of the pincer arms to be fully retracted to capture cables in tight spaces. Automatic measurement parameter detection ensures reliable work enabling automation detection of DC and AC and the selection of other parameters such as resistance, continuity, diode and capacitance. It is available in three models: the standard 770-1; the 770-2, which includes a μA range and an integrated temperature adapter for all type K thermocouples; and the 770-3, which offers additional functions such as performance measurement and integrated Bluetooth, allowing the instrument to be connected to the Testo Smart Probes App. Within this app, measurement progression can be shown as a graph or a table and the results can also be directly communicated via email.
The Testo 755 current-voltage tester family is ideal for most daily electrical measuring tasks. Automatically selecting the right settings, the devices have all the important functions for determining voltage/deenergising for measuring current and resistance, as well as for continuity tests. The integrated flashlight enables dark spots to be illuminated and the measuring tips can be changed easily, saving costs in the event of damage.
The three models in the Testo 750 range are the first voltage testers with an all-round LED display, which can be seen from any position and guarantees an ideal voltage indication due to its unique fibre optics. They meet the latest standards including EN61243-3:2010 and CAT IV, as well as providing the most important functions for voltage testing, continuity testing and rotating magnetic field measurement.
Finally, the Testo 745 non-contact voltage tester comes with a voltage range of up to 1000 V and is ideal for the fast initial checking of any suspected fault sources, and provides clear visual and acoustic signals when voltage is detected. The device also has a low-pass filter for high-frequency interference signals and also meets IP67.
